The world’s most expensive bouquet has been painstakingly created — with a rice of €1 million euros.
Floral artist Yusif Khalilov created the arrangement using exclusive, high-end blooms sourced directly from select greenhouses.
Then they were given added sparkle with white gold accents and diamonds.
The arrangement features rare flowers including a variety of roses known as “Sofie” and “Wedding Invite”.
It also utilises black Calla lilies, and chocolate brown Vanda orchids.
Each diamond is nestled within the petals creating a bright sparkle designed to catch the light from every angle.
The white gold accents frame the precious stones adding a contrast to the soft, natural beauty of the flowers.
The deep purples of the chocolate Vanda orchids and black Calla lilies are meant to provide a striking contrast against the blush and cream tones of the spray roses.

What is said to be one of the world’s most expensive Martini cocktails is being served up at a fine dining restaurant — with a $13,000 USD / €11.735 euros price tag
It comes with a dazzling necklace from US jewellery brand Marrow Fine whose fans include Barbie actress Margot Robbie and music star Machine Gun Kelly.
Marrow Fine joined with Chicago’s Adalina restaurant for the Marrow Martini, said to be the most expensive Martini in the United States.
The necklace , known as a tennis design, features 150 diamonds weighing a total of 9 carats and set in14k gold.
The piece is paired with a smoked heirloom tomato mezcal Martini created by Adalina’s award winning sommelier Colin Hofer.
